+baffmeister Posted November 19, 2015 Posted November 19, 2015 My observations regarding that issue from past experience. When leveling an airfield using the TW terrain editor the leveling process makes changes to both the HFD and TFD files. Your screen shot looks like what I saw in the past when I added just the new HFD file but not the new TFD file. Not 100% sure if the terrain editor you're using actually makes the required changes in the TFD file. The updated Desert 4 terrain by Piecemeal/Centurion exhibits the same issue with some airports. Some of the airfield texture tiles were changed but I don't think they were re-leveled using the TW terrain editor. Quote
Wrench Posted November 19, 2015 Posted November 19, 2015 1) always use the 3w terrain editor for airfield zone flattening. the TFD tool is not prescise enough in it's height adjustments (all or nothing) 2) minimum size for runways 1, 2,3,5,6 is 5km x 5km (must ALWAYS be square). 6 x 6 is also good, and needed for runway 4 3) as Baff said, you must have BOTH the updated HFD and TFD. I, too found that out the hard way. Quote

Wrench Posted November 21, 2015 Posted November 21, 2015 remember, changing the HF statements in the terrain's data ini are global changes, while using the TE to flatten 1 (or 2 or 12) airfields are specific and localized height field changes but, hey! if it don't change nothing else...and it works :) Quote
